Some people may worry about obtaining a law degree with anxiety, but it is completely possible. Anxiety is common in the legal profession! There are different types of lawyers, some who spend time in the courtroom or spend their time researching and legal writing outside of the courtroom. If you’d rather spend time working individually rather than interacting with others, there are plenty of opportunities for you in law. If your environment gives you anxiety, the simple solution is to change the environment you practice in. Simply applying to other firms or moving to a new area can resolve environment anxiety in law. As well as taking a step back to realize that this is the lifelong career you really want to pursue and learn how to overcome obstacles to achieve your dream of becoming a lawyer.

Attorneys struggle to manage stress since their workload is so intense. There are many effective ways of coping with anxiety as a lawyer. Meditation, exercise, reading a book, avoiding caffeine, and sleeping more can help improve anxiety! If you are worried about social anxiety, therapists can help you combat your worries and help you earn success in the court room. Social anxiety can impact areas in your entire life and not just your professional career. It is always recommended to seek out help and master your social skills!
